Diseases

Show/Hide Table
Disease IDSourceNameDescription
611726 OMIMEpilepsy, progressive myoclonic 3, with or without intracellular inclusions (EPM3)A form of progressive myoclonic epilepsy, a clinically and genetically heterogeneous group of disorders defined by the combination of action and reflex myoclonus, other types of epileptic seizures, and progressive neurodegeneration and neurocognitive impairment. EPM3 is an autosomal recessive, severe, form with early onset. Multifocal myoclonic seizures begin between 16 and 24 months of age after normal initial development. Neurodegeneration and regression occur with seizure onset. Other features include mental retardation, dysarthria, truncal ataxia, and loss of fine finger movements. EEG shows slow dysrhythmia, multifocal and occasionally generalized epileptiform discharges. In some patients, ultrastructural findings on skin biopsies identify intracellular accumulation of autofluorescent lipopigment storage material, consistent with neuronal ceroid lipofuscinosis. The disease is caused by variants affecting the gene represented in this entry.
